Hi,

  I notice an issue on the Leshan sandbox this morning.
  Both, http://leshan.eclipse.org/ and http://leshan.eclipse.org/bs/ didn't respond.

  Looking at apache log I see :

...
[Mon Jun 25 12:03:21.247636 2018] [mpm_event:error] [pid 4268:tid 129245195483008] AH00485: scoreboard is full, not at MaxRequestWorkers
[Mon Jun 25 12:03:22.248814 2018] [mpm_event:error] [pid 4268:tid 129245195483008] AH00485: scoreboard is full, not at MaxRequestWorkers
[Mon Jun 25 12:03:23.249994 2018] [mpm_event:error] [pid 4268:tid 129245195483008] AH00485: scoreboard is full, not at MaxRequestWorkers
[Mon Jun 25 12:03:24.251169 2018] [mpm_event:error] [pid 4268:tid 129245195483008] AH00485: scoreboard is full, not at MaxRequestWorkers
[Mon Jun 25 12:03:25.252308 2018] [mpm_event:error] [pid 4268:tid 129245195483008] AH00485: scoreboard is full, not at MaxRequestWorkers
...

   It seems this is an old bug of apache httpd : https://bz.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=53555
   It is fixed since 2.4.25 but we have an old 2.4.10.

   I check the system we used and this is a Ubuntu 15.04 which is not supported since 4th Feb 2016.

   I think we should go at least for a supported LTS version. (ideally I would prefer to go with a debian stable, but an Ubuntu migration should be simple)
